Smart grid energy resilience refers to the ability of modernized electrical grids to anticipate, withstand, recover from, and adapt to adverse conditions, such as natural disasters, cyberattacks, or equipment failures. A resilient smart grid is characterized by several key features, including: Advanced sensing and monitoring. . Photovoltaic (PV) technology is an ideal solution for the electrical supply issues that trouble the current climate-change, carbon-intensive world of power generation. PV systems can generate electricity at remote utility-operated "solar farms" or be placed directly on buildings themselves.
